Three interacting bugs reported by a user (Discord/ericepe) on a fresh install: 1. The state reconciler retried failed auto-repairs on every HTTP request, pegging CPU and flooding logs with "Plugin not found in registry: github / youtube". Root cause: ``_run_startup_reconciliation`` reset ``_reconciliation_started`` to False on any unresolved inconsistency, so ``@app.before_request`` re-fired the entire pass on the next request. Fix: run reconciliation exactly once per process; cache per-plugin unrecoverable failures inside the reconciler so even an explicit re-trigger stays cheap; add a registry pre-check to skip the expensive GitHub fetch when we already know the plugin is missing; expose ``force=True`` on ``/plugins/state/reconcile`` so users can retry after fixing the underlying issue. 2. Uninstalling a plugin via the UI succeeded but the plugin reappeared. Root cause: a race between ``store_manager.uninstall_plugin`` (removes files) and ``cleanup_plugin_config`` (removes config entry) — if reconciliation fired in the gap it saw "config entry with no files" and reinstalled. Fix: reorder uninstall to clean config FIRST, drop a short-lived "recently uninstalled" tombstone on the store manager that the reconciler honors, and pass ``store_manager`` to the manual ``/plugins/state/reconcile`` endpoint (it was previously omitted, which silently disabled auto-repair entirely). 3. ``GET /plugins/installed`` was very slow on a Pi4 (UI hung on "connecting to display" for minutes, ~98% CPU). Root causes: per-request ``discover_plugins()`` + manifest re-read + four ``git`` subprocesses per plugin (``rev-parse``, ``--abbrev-ref``, ``config``, ``log``). Fix: mtime-gate ``discover_plugins()`` and drop the per-plugin manifest re-read in the endpoint; cache ``_get_local_git_info`` keyed on ``.git/HEAD`` mtime so subprocesses only run when the working copy actually moved; bump registry cache TTL from 5 to 15 minutes and fall back to stale cache on transient network failure. Tests: 16 reconciliation cases (including 5 new ones covering the unrecoverable cache, force-reconcile path, transient-failure handling, and recently-uninstalled tombstone) and 8 new store_manager cache tests covering tombstone TTL, git-info mtime cache hit/miss, and the registry stale-cache fallback. All 24 pass; the broader 288-test suite continues to pass with no new failures. Co-Authored-By: Claude Opus 4.6 (1M context) <noreply@anthropic.com>
